Tulsi Gabbard confirmed as national intelligence director
By a vote of 52-48, the Senate confirmed Tulsi Gabbard to be President Donald Trump’s national intelligence director. Senator Mitch McConnell voted alongside the Democrats against Gabbard’s confirmation. The Republicans had to invoke cloture to make this vote possible.
